A Business Process Management System based on a General Optimium Criterion
MAZILESCU, Vasile; SARPE, Daniela; NECULITA, Mihaela; … - In: Economics and Applied Informatics (2009) 1, pp. 77-92
Business Process Management Systems (BPMS) provide a broad range of facilities to manage operational business processes. These systems should provide support for the complete Business Process Management (BPM) life-cycle (16): (re)design, configuration, execution, control, and diagnosis of...
